Thirty two HIV-infected children, on highly active antiretroviral therapy (HAART) and > 500 CD4(+) T cells/mm(3), were rated according to the time-course of viral load (VL) during the whole follow-up period (> 18 months) in a longitudinal retrospective study. ( a) uVL group: 15 children with VL below 400 copies/mL; ( b) dVL group: 17 children with higher VL. The uVL group showed higher memory ( CD4(+)CD45RO(+)) T cells than did dVL group, and higher number of memory activated CD4(+)CD45RO(+)HLA-DR+ than did control group ( healthy age-matched uninfected children), whereas CD4(+)CD45RA(hi+)CD62L(+) was similar. However, TCR rearrangement excision circles ( TRECs) were higher in uVL group than in dVL group. uVL Group showed CD8(+)CD45RO(+) and CD8(+)CD45RO(+)CD38(+) higher number than the control group, but lower than the dVL group. The percentage of CD8(+)CD45RA(hi+)CD62L(+), CD8(+)CD45RA(+), CD8(+)CD62L(+), and CD8(+)CD28(+) was higher in uVL group than in dVL group, and lower than in control group. The uVL group showed higher number of activated (HLA-DR(+)CD38(+), HLA-DR+, HLA-DR(+)CD38(-)) CD4(+) T cells and lower percentages of CD4(+)HLA-DR(-)CD38(+) than dVL group. In activated CD8(+) T cell, the uVL group had lower CD8(+)HLA-DR(+)CD38(+), CD8(+)HLA-DR+, and CD8(+)CD38(+) than the dVL group. Preeffector (CD8(+)CD57(-)CD28(-) and CD8(+)CD45RA(-)CD62L(-)) T cells were lower in the uVL group than in dVL group. In the effector ( CD8(+)CD57(+), CD8(+)CD57(+)CD28(-), and CD8(+)CD45RA(+)CD62L(-)) T cells, HIV-infected-children had higher values than control group. HIV-infected-children who respond to HAART had TRECs reconstitution, decreased immune activation, and lower effector CD8(+) T cells. Moreover, successful HAART allow the increment of activated CD4(+) T cells.
